Why Does Sonic Seem Weaker in the Movies? Sonic is known for his insane speed, but in the movies, his power levels seem all over the place. One moment, he’s zooming across the ocean in seconds, and the next, he’s struggling to outrun an avalanche. What’s up with that? Take Sonic 2, When he and Tails get caught in an avalanche, instead of just speeding to safety, Sonic calls Tom for help—why? And if he was fast enough to dodge Knuckles at times, why did their big fight feel so evenly matched? At first, Knuckles completely overpowers him, but later, they’re suddenly on equal footing. This weird power inconsistency carries into Sonic 3, where Sonic struggles against Shadow in every fight—only to knock him out with one punch by the end. And let’s not forget the first movie. With all his crazy reflexes, how did he fail to dodge a simple tranquilizer dart? Is Sonic getting slowed down for story reasons, or is there a deeper explanation? Let me know what you think!
